Martinez Earns All-ACC First Team Honor
11/8/2012 12:00:00 AM | Men's Soccer
Nov. 8, 2012
NC State's Alex Martinez earned a spot on the All-ACC First Team, announced Thursday by the conference.
"I'm very pleased for Alex," said NC State head coach Kelly Findley. "He possesses a lot of ability, but he earned this honor through his hard work this summer. Every player has room for growth, and I know Alex wants to reach his full potential. He'll be a big part of our program again next year."
The junior transfer from High Point made an instant impact over his first year with NC State, helping the Pack climb as high as No. 14 in the national rankings during the squad's best start since 1982. Martinez spent the season ranked among the ACC's leaders in goals, assists, and points. He finished the season with 32 points on 11 goals and 10 assists.
The last time an NC State soccer player recorded double-digit goals and assists in a single season came with Henry Gutierrez's 10 goal, 13 assist effort in 1991.
Martinez represents the Wolfpack's first double-digit goal scorer since Ronnie Bouemboue's 14 goals in 2008, and notches the first double-digit assist total since Bouemboue's 10 in 2009. Martinez's 32 points equal a mark set by Bouemboue in 2008.
The Rock Hill, S.C. native becomes the first player in the Kelly Findley-era to land on the first team. The last Wolfpacker to make the first team was Alan Sanchez in 2009.
